All in all, OTN technology shows both a technical leap forward in optical networking over SONET/SDH and a business chances for carriers and service suppliers alike. OTN networks can fully leverage the transport infrastructure in the era of data/transport convergence by providing carriers unprecedented architectural flexibility, client-protocol independence, and service differentiation. OTN network has come of age and will positively continue to rise as traffic necessity grows.

On Contrary, Ethernet is now being regarded a valuable choice for mobile transport, accessibility, and metro networks as OTN are only serving the purpose of huge bitrate long-haul transport. Moreover, as Ethernet today also comprises FEC, it may replace OTN in the future for long-haul if IEEE chooses to state long-haul Ethernet interfaces.
